Well, for the first time in longer than I can remember, I missed a doe tonight. [:' (]
But, if she would have been 5 yards farther out, I would have gotten her.:D:D 2 does came by with 10 minutes of shooting light left. I thought they were 10 yards away. I drew back, and I couldnt see that darned black broadhead good. (I use the arrow tip as a reference.) I picked my spot, released, and watched both deer bound away. As they were running out, I thought, " wow, seems to be going pretty good for just getting shot" . I climbed down, and found my arrow, clean as a whistle. Scratching my head I paced off 10 yard to the stand. [:o] I coulda swore it was 15. Oh well, I still got lots of season left to try again. On the up side, 15 minutes after I shot a real gully washer of a rain came through. Probably best that I didnt hit it, or I wouldnt have had any blood left to trail. One things for sure, I sure buried an arrow in the ground, I hit that perfectly. :D[&:][&:]:D |

Kip, just remember, a clean miss is better than a bad hit. With that rain coming in also, it may have been a blessing in disguise. I remember a nice buck I hit one evening right behind the shoulder. Before I could get to the ground, the skies opened up. I went right to the spot where I had seen him running last, and there I found both pieces of my arrow covered in blood. I started to trail him from there and in about 10 minutes, all blood had disappeared. Had no choice but to start a grid search and never did find that buck. Felt terrible and have never forgotten it. As hard as you hunt, there will be another shot, its only a matter of time. Good luck, John
